Those numbers are the hexadecimal version of the decimal value you're looking for. To find the decimal value, open up the calculator that comes with your PC and make sure it's using the scientific view (not the basic view). See the little button marked hex? For me it's on the far left, just under the display bar. Click on that. Now, under the numbers you can see the letters a-f. Now that you're enabled hex, you can enter the combination of numbers and letters you're seeing the the 2da file. Once you've entered the number, click the Dec button right next to the hex button and you'll get the decimal version.
